Thailand, Cambodia agree on ‘immediate ceasefire’ after weeks of deadly border clashes

Thailand and Cambodia have agreed to an immediate ceasefire following weeks of deadly clashes along their disputed border. The development was confirmed through a joint statement by the defence ministers of both countries, signalling a pause in hostilities and an effort to de-escalate tensions.

The ceasefire is expected to help stabilise the situation on the ground and open the door for further diplomatic engagement to address the underlying border issues that triggered the recent violence.
